美國(guó)服務(wù)器ICMP協(xié)議的漏洞如何防御
了解ICMP協(xié)議
ICMP(Internet Control Message Protocol)是互聯(lián)網(wǎng)控制消息協(xié)議,用于在IP網(wǎng)絡(luò)中傳輸錯(cuò)誤報(bào)告和操作信息,它允許主機(jī)或路由器發(fā)送差錯(cuò)報(bào)告報(bào)文以及有關(guān)異常情況的報(bào)告給其他設(shè)備。
常見的ICMP攻擊類型
1、ICMP Flood攻擊:攻擊者通過發(fā)送大量的ICMP請(qǐng)求報(bào)文,使目標(biāo)服務(wù)器資源耗盡,導(dǎo)致服務(wù)不可用。
2、ICMP Smurf攻擊:攻擊者冒充受害者的IP地址,向一個(gè)大的網(wǎng)絡(luò)發(fā)送ICMP echo請(qǐng)求報(bào)文,將響應(yīng)報(bào)文放大并轉(zhuǎn)發(fā)給該網(wǎng)絡(luò)內(nèi)的多個(gè)主機(jī)。
3、ICMP Redirect攻擊:攻擊者發(fā)送虛假的ICMP重定向報(bào)文,引導(dǎo)目標(biāo)主機(jī)連接到惡意服務(wù)器。
防御ICMP攻擊的方法
1、過濾ICMP報(bào)文:使用防火墻或其他網(wǎng)絡(luò)安全設(shè)備,設(shè)置規(guī)則來過濾掉不必要的ICMP報(bào)文,減少對(duì)系統(tǒng)資源的占用。
2、限制ICMP流量:限制ICMP報(bào)文的流量和速率,防止被大量ICMP請(qǐng)求報(bào)文淹沒。
3、使用網(wǎng)絡(luò)入侵檢測(cè)系統(tǒng)(IDS):部署IDS來監(jiān)測(cè)和檢測(cè)ICMP攻擊行為,及時(shí)發(fā)現(xiàn)并采取相應(yīng)的防御措施。
4、更新操作系統(tǒng)和應(yīng)用程序:及時(shí)安裝操作系統(tǒng)和應(yīng)用程序的安全補(bǔ)丁,修復(fù)已知的漏洞,提高系統(tǒng)的安全性。
5、配置路由器和交換機(jī):在網(wǎng)絡(luò)設(shè)備上配置訪問控制列表(ACL),限制ICMP報(bào)文的傳輸范圍,減少潛在的攻擊風(fēng)險(xiǎn)。
6、實(shí)施虛擬專用網(wǎng)絡(luò)(VPN):使用VPN技術(shù)加密通信流量,防止敏感數(shù)據(jù)被竊聽和篡改。
相關(guān)問題與解答:
問題1:為什么需要防御ICMP攻擊?
答案:ICMP攻擊可以導(dǎo)致服務(wù)器資源耗盡、服務(wù)不可用甚至系統(tǒng)崩潰,對(duì)網(wǎng)絡(luò)安全造成威脅,防御ICMP攻擊是保護(hù)服務(wù)器安全的重要措施之一。
問題2:如何確定是否遭受了ICMP攻擊?
答案:可以通過以下方式來確定是否遭受了ICMP攻擊:
監(jiān)控網(wǎng)絡(luò)流量和日志:使用網(wǎng)絡(luò)監(jiān)控工具來實(shí)時(shí)監(jiān)測(cè)網(wǎng)絡(luò)流量和日志,發(fā)現(xiàn)異常的ICMP報(bào)文活動(dòng)。
分析系統(tǒng)性能:如果服務(wù)器出現(xiàn)異常高負(fù)載、響應(yīng)緩慢或服務(wù)不可用的情況,可能是受到了ICMP攻擊。
使用IDS和防火墻警報(bào):部署IDS和防火墻來監(jiān)測(cè)和檢測(cè)ICMP攻擊行為,及時(shí)發(fā)出警報(bào)并采取相應(yīng)的防御措施。